Judge Caprio Dismisses Charges When He Learns Why Vet is In Court

Judge Caprio is making the internet rounds for his soft spot for those down on their luck. He knows just how to spot the ones who need a hand up. Caprio’s caring side doesn’t disappoint when he finds out why this vet is in court. “The smallest thing can change someone’s life,” Caprio shared with Stars and Stripes. “[My father’s] mantra was help people when you can. We were taught in life that it’s not enough to climb the ladder of success.” You have to lead down the ladder “so others can follow in your footsteps.” A Vietnam veteran stood before Judge Caprio and shared that he was pleading guilty to his parking ticket but wanted to explain the situation. As a frequent patient at the local Veterans Affairs Hospital (V.A.) the man like others, had nowhere to park. Knowing he was parking illegally, the veteran explained that for years they had parked on these side streets thinking the parking authorities were deliberately giving them a “break”. Unfortunately, that wasn’t to be and the man was given a $100 fine. Thankfully for the veteran, he was standing before Judge Caprio who is a veteran himself and known for his generous rulings especially towards veterans. But his appreciation doesn’t stop there, Caprio shares his soft spot for Vietnam veterans in particular. “I have a particular affinity for all veterans,” he said. “But especially those who served in Vietnam. I remember how the vets were adored in World War II, and how they were scorned when they came home from ‘Nam. It’s a sad chapter in our history.” What a blessing Judge Caprio is to those who are in difficult situations. Dog Travels 3,000 Miles to Reunite with Soldier Who Rescued Her

Sean Laidlaw is a soldier who was leading a bomb disposal team while he was stationed in Syria. One day, Sean found a scared, sweet pup amidst the rubble. He named her Barrie and brought her food and water and checked in on her daily. Barrie was reluctant to accept Sean’s help at first, but after a few days, she finally came around. Over the next few months that Sean was in Syria, he and Barrie grew close. He even made the pup a bullet-proof vest so she could be with him during the day. ‘When we got back to camp, she lived in my room, I looked after her, I was responsible for her. She slept in my room, I was training her, I was feeding her. ‘She stayed with me every day all day. She did jobs with me, I’d wake up, she’d come eat with me, she’d then sit in the passenger seat of my car when we drove to Raqqa.’ Sean told the Metro. Then Sean learned he’d be going home. While he was obviously excited, he was sad to leave Barrie behind! So he called an organization in Iraq who specialized in rescuing dogs from war-torn areas. Then he started raising money to bring his dog home! The organization was able to get the dog to Iraq, and flew her to Jordan, and then Paris. Each stop along the way, Barrie had to be quarantined to make sure she was healthy enough to leave that country! By the time Sean was able to meet Barrie, seven long months had passed. Sean drove 12 hours from his home in the UK to go to Paris to pick Barrie up and finally bring her home! So then, after five countries, two war zones and more than 3,000 miles, the two were finally reunited for what Sean describes as his “happiest moment ever.” Is there anything better than the unconditional love of a sweet pup?

Her Ex Left Her With Parking Tickets But Judge Caprio Knew Better

When a frazzled looking mom wheeled a stroller into the courtroom and towed small kids alongside her, Judge Frank Caprio joked, asking her “Are these your lawyers you have with you? Who are they?” The woman, who admitted to being a little nervous, asked for more time to pay a parking ticket. The judge looked through her file and noticed several other past due tickets. When he pointed them out to the young woman, he got a sense that more was going on than meets the eye. Judge Frank Caprio has gained internet fame for his fair court rulings and understanding demeanor though he insists, “I’m not here on the court to be an entertainer . . . my primary role is to do justice.” Judge Caprio is the Chief Municipal Judge in Providence, Rhode Island. And while he’s aware the cameras are rolling in his courtroom, he knows that the real reason he is there is to do his job. The young woman merely stated that her children’s father got the parking tickets. She didn’t ask for the tickets to be dismissed or claim that she shouldn’t be responsible for paying them. She initially simply asked for more time to pay. The judge invited the woman’s 7-year-old daughter to the stand to help him make his decision. He asked the young girl if he should fine her mother $175 or not. The girl thought he meant ‘find’ her money and said, ‘yes’ until the kindly judge explained what he meant. Judge Caprio, who is known for being kind in addition to being fair, told the woman he wasn’t going to make her pay the tickets, and the woman broke down crying in relief. The judge shared that though the woman hadn’t said so, he suspected the children’s father wasn’t “meeting his obligations as he should be.” “Thank you,” the emotional mom said, wiping tears from her face as they streamed down her face. Quick-Thinking 13-year-old Rescued Himself After Shark Attack

Keane Webre-Hayes was just a typical teenager wading in the ocean with his friend before the unthinkable happened. He was diving for lobsters just off the California shore when suddenly something slam into him. “I feel something tackle me and it took my mask off,” he explained. “At first I thought it was [my friend] Noah trying to mess with me, trying to scare me. Then I come up, my mask is off, I’m all confused, and then I look over.” That’s when he realized it was a shark. What the 13-year-old shark attack victim did next saved his life! “My wetsuit is all ripped up, and blood is starting to go into the water. I look up, and I see Noah’s snorkel still in the water, so I know it wasn’t Noah, and then just by instinct I start swimming to that kayak as fast as I can and I’m screaming for help, help, help … Shark! … I swim to the kayak, I pull myself on, and I tell the guy we have to get to shore.” Even injured, Keane kept his wits about him, and so he had made his way quickly to a nearby kayak. Getting himself out of the water so quickly is what saved his life. “It’s lucky we got him out of the water because once we threw him up on the kayak and started heading in, that’s when I looked back and a shark was behind the kayak,” shared kayaker Chad hammel. Fortunately the kayakers were nearby when the attack happened. Keane’s mom was nearby on the phone with his dad when she had an ominous feeling wash over her. “I was on a cliff above the beach, I was on the phone with my husband, the sun was coming up and it was kind of an eery feeling out there … In the background I started hearing probably just the worst screams I’ve ever heard in my life,” she told People. Little did she know, these sounds were her own son calling out in pain. Once the kayak made it to shore, everyone started yelling to get others out of the water. “Shark! Get out of the water!” they yelled, sending Keane’s mother running down the beach to make sure her son was ok. The kayakers and lifeguards rushed to get Keane medical treatment. Keane was in critical condition when he arrived at the hospital. More than 1,000 stitches later, doctors were proud of the work they had done, but said the boy had a long road to recovery ahead of him. While he was in the hospital, his spirits were lifted by visits from professional surfer and fellow shark attack survivor Bethany Hamilton, and by star skateboarder Tony Hawk. The smiling teen shared that he’s eager to get back in the ocean, and returned to school just two and a half weeks after his traumatic accident to share his inspiring survival story with his classmates.

How Alzheimer's Affects Struggling Families

Not many families are left untouched by the effects of Alzheimer’s Disease. The Forbes family is battling a common crisis as exhausted caregivers while this Navy vet fights Alzheimer’s in their home. Robin and daughter Haley Forbes lovingly care for Robin’s 82-year-old father, Jim. The U.S. Navy veteran is battling Alzheimer’s. The pair return home after work and school to pick up the care of Jim who is wheelchair bound and struggles with daily tasks. After Jim’s diagnosis, he and Robin’s mother moved in with her. Taking the day shift, Robin’s boyfriend Desi cares for her parents while she works. She and Haley split mornings and evenings. It’s exhausting for them all. “I worry about my Mom, then like, she has to worry about me. So I wish there was more of a balance.” Haley shares. As more Baby Boomers are aging, their families are becoming caregivers unable to afford sound facility care. While the opportunity to care for a parent is something that many adult children expect and dutifully take on, the burden of full-time care is overwhelming. “I worry about it all day long at work. It’s draining, it’s emotionally stressful.” Robin knows that she isn’t alone. More and more families are taking on the care of their aging loved ones, and many are fighting Alzheimer’s grip on their parents. The TODAY show shares that there are 16 million family caregivers and of them, 60% suffer high emotional stress and 40% suffer from depression. But what is more shocking is the 250,000 children under 18 who are also stepping in as caregivers. Haley told host Maria Shriver, “I don’t wanna always ask my Mom for help, because that’s always putting so much on her plate.” Robin broke down in tears hearing her young daughter vocalize her worries. “As her mom, I don’t want her to ever have to worry about stuff like that. I want her to worry about being a kid. I don’t want her to think that uh, it’s ‘putting too much more on my plate’.” Because of caring for her parents, Robin shares that she doesn’t remember the last time she was able to go to the doctor for herself. “I don’t have time.” It’s something that many caregivers agree on as they feel the weight of the care overwhelms them. Many of the caregivers are women who also have to work outside of the home, living paycheck to paycheck to afford their monthly bills. Of course, the time being a blessing to parents who need us is not overlooked. While caregiving is exhausting work, there is something truly heroic about those who step up to be there for their loved ones. Seeing a family member age is never easy and with a disease like Alzheimer’s more adult children are wishing they had made more time in their schedules before their parents were ill. “Take advantage of the time that you have with your loved one. There is some guilt of not spending time with them when we had the opportunities.”

Divine Intervention Sends Dying Baby to Man's Porch Steps

Carlos Rodriguez wasn't supposed to be at his house that Monday. But thanks to divine intervention, this godly man was home when a neighbor in dire need rang his bell. And what he did next made him a hero. He'd never even been officially trained, but he prayed and performed CPR in front of Jesus portrait, and it saved a dying baby's life! Carlos had stayed home from work that week because he had family visiting from out of town. Because of that, Carlos would be at his house when he normally wouldn't have been.  Down the street, Carlos' neighbor ran out of her home screaming. Then she ran straight to Carlos' home, running past several other houses. This was not a coincidence--it was divine intervention!  What Carlos saw when he opened the door would haunt him for months afterward. His neighbor was standing on his porch in hysterics clutching her lifeless baby. All the baby's mother could utter to Carlos was one word, "water." She had left her 13-month-old son alone in the bathtub for just a moment, only to return and find him floating."He was completely lifeless. His body was a different color. He was blue. He had no pulse."  Carlos rushed the baby into the house, silently praying as he started administering CPR. He'd never received official training but had self-taught himself CPR skills by watching YouTube videos when he had his first child. “I knew enough,” he said. After a few moments, the baby started to breathe. Shortly after, the first responders would arrive. They all agree that Carlos had saved the baby's life. "It was amazing. It was awesome just to look him in the eye and know that he’s alive," said Rodriguez. "It’s probably one of the greatest moments in my life." It wasn’t until after the fact that Carlos realized where he'd ended up taking the drowned baby. He’d performed CPR in front of a portrait of Jesus Christ. “God definitely had a big part in this,” Carlos said. "Later I asked her, 'why did you come to my house', and she said that God guided her here."  Carlos was terrified by what almost happened to that poor baby. "I have three little kids," Carlos said, "and just to have them lifeless and not know if they’re going to come back, it’s so scary." The idea tormented Carlos so much that he struggled with fear of giving his own children baths for a while after the incident. Then he became inspired to use the traumatic events for good. He shared his story, and 20 of his friends and family members went to get CPR certified! Now he's encouraging everyone to become CPR certified. "I think it’s just so important to raise awareness about knowing how to do CPR, because like it happened to me. You just never know when you’re going to be in a position where you have to save a life," Carlos said. “Somebody could literally come to your door with a baby that’s lifeless and ask you for help,” he said.
